Governor Signs Soto Bill To Increase Security In Courthouses

 

Governor Arnold Schwarzenegger today signed SB 584, a bill by State Senator Nell Soto (D – Pomona) to increase security in courthouses and other government buildings.

Specifically, Soto’s measure expands existing misdemeanor trespass laws to prohibit intentionally avoiding the screening and inspection procedures in courthouses as well as other city, county, or state buildings.

"As recent events clearly show, we must give courthouses additional tools for protecting the safety of people working there, people seeking redress, those selected to serve on juries, individuals who go to court to conduct business and even men or women whose presence is required,” Soto said.

Prior to SB 584, there were no laws governing individuals who intentionally avoided submitting to the screening and inspection processes at courthouses and public buildings. Soto’s measure now makes it a misdemeanor to do, punishable by up to a year in county jail.
